Baby Unit SET UP & USE:
• Choose a location for the Baby Unit that will provide the best view
of your baby in their cot.
• Place the Baby Unit on a flat surface, such as a dresser, desk,
or shelf or mount the Unit securely using the Flexible Grip ( Not
Included ) or Tripod mount screw hole on the underside of the
stand.
• NEVER place the Baby Unit or cords in the cot or within reach of
the baby (the unit and cords should be more than 1m away).
WARNING
This Smart Baby Monitor is compliant with all relevant standards regarding
electromagnetic fields and is, when handled as described in the User's
Guide, safe to use. Therefore, always read the instructions in this User's
Guide carefully before using the device.
• Adult assembly is required. Keep small parts away from children when
assembling.
• This product is not a toy. Do not allow children to play with it.
• This Baby Monitor is not a substitute for responsible adult supervision.
• Keep this User's Guide for future reference.
• Do not place the Baby Unit or cords in the cot or within reach of the baby
(the unit and cords should be more than 1m away).
• Keep the cords out of reach of children.
• Do not cover the Baby Monitor with a towel, blanket, or other items that
will stop air circulation.
• Never use extension cords with power adaptors. Only use supplied power
adaptors.
• Test this monitor and all its functions so that you are familiar with it prior to
actual use.
• Do not use the Baby Monitor near water or allow water or other foreign
substances to enter the power port or adaptor.
